, founded in 1956. Havelock is one of three high schools operated by the Craven County School District. The original campus is now the site of Havelock Middle School, and the current campus was built in 1971, although it has been expanded several times since. or James City. The past principal of the school has been Jeff Murphy since 2005 although he retired in 2019, and the current principal is Stacie Friebel.
